  1. HE 6/2023 vpPassed

    Safeguarding supplementary pension and sickness funds

    Supplementary pension foundations and funds established earlier will be allowed to continue their operations to their previous extent to pay voluntary supplementary pensions. Small sickness funds and other insurance funds that have received an exemption will also be permitted to continue operating below the statutory minimum size.

  2. HE 28/2021 vpPassed with amendments

    Improving operating conditions for pension funds

    The regulation governing pension foundations, pension funds and insurance funds will be reformed and divided into three clearer acts. The reform will make it easier to establish and operate pension foundations and funds by lowering their required minimum size.

  3. HE 313/2018 vpPassed with amendments

    Reforming pension institutions' stewardship and transparency

    All earnings-related pension institutions will be placed under a statutory obligation to draw up and publish their principles of ownership steering. The change will increase transparency in the investment of earnings-related pension assets and in acting as shareholders.

  4. HE 205/2018 vpPassed with amendments

    Reforming regulation of supplementary pension institutions

    Rules on the governance, supervision and information provided to insured persons by pension foundations and funds offering voluntary supplementary pensions will be reformed. Insured persons will begin receiving an annual free pension benefit statement on accrued pension rights and pension projections.

  5. HE 265/2016 vpPassed

    Deregulating pension and insurance fund investments

    Pension foundations and insurance funds will be able to invest their assets more freely in OECD countries outside the European Economic Area (EEA). In addition, quantitative restrictions on real estate investments by institutions providing voluntary supplementary pensions will be removed.

  6. HE 98/2015 vpPassed with amendments

    Clarifying insurance sector accounting rules

    Accounting provisions for insurance companies, pension foundations and insurance funds will be harmonised with general accounting legislation, and overlapping text in the acts will be pruned. The changes will streamline financial reporting in the sector.
